Telangana ICET 2025 Registration Update

The Telangana Council of Higher Education (TGCHE) has announced an extension for the registration deadline for the Telangana Integrated Common Entrance Test (TG ICET) 2025. Eligible candidates can now register for the exam on the official website until May 10 without incurring a late fee. For those who miss this deadline, applications can still be submitted with a late fee of Rs 250 until May 17 and Rs 500 until May 26.

The correction window for applications will be available from May 16 to May 20, 2025. The examination is scheduled to take place on June 8 and 9, with two shifts: the first from 10:00 AM to 12:30 PM and the second from 2:30 PM to 5:00 PM. Candidates can expect the admit card to be released on May 28, 2025. More information can be found in the notification linked below:


Application Fee Details Application Fee

Applicants from the general category are required to pay a fee of Rs 750, while candidates belonging to SC/ST and differently-abled categories need to pay Rs 550.
